Logo
Resource Informatics Group

Azure DevOps Lead Engineer

Resource Informatics Group, Alpharetta, Georgia, United States, 30239


Azure DevOps Lead EngineerAlpharetta, GA (Day1 Onsite)Relocations are fineRate: OpenNeed someone on W2 or 1099.Client: Photon/Client

TOP Skills:

Azure DevOps, DevSecOps, OAuth, OPA,Harness

DescriptionA demonstrable understanding of the full Software Delivery Lifecycle Has demonstrable experience delivering high availability auto scaling containerized deployments in Azure Kubernetes & Docker experience. Experience owning infrastructure in production, as well as designing and creating build/deploy & monitoring systems. Engage with cross-functional teams in design, development and implementation of enterprise scalable features related to enabling higher developer productivity, environment monitoring and self-healing, and facilitate autonomous delivery teams. In depth understanding of continuous integration, continuous delivery, software configuration management, version control and release management.We are seeking a skilled DevOps Engineer with expertise in Azure DevOps, AKS (Azure Kubernetes Service), Teraform, Canary deployment, Helm, OPA (Open Policy Agent), Istio, Kibana, FluentD, Kayenta, OpenTelemetry, and Azure Monitor. The ideal candidate will have a strong background in implementing and managing DevOps practices, automation, and cloud infrastructure, with specific experience in these technologies.Responsibilities:

Design, implement, and maintain CI/CD pipelines using Azure DevOps for efficient and automated application deployment.Deploy and manage containerized applications using AKS (Azure Kubernetes Service) and utilize Helm for package management.Implement Canary deployment strategies to ensure smooth and controlled rollouts of new features and updates.Collaborate with development and operations teams to streamline processes and optimize the software delivery lifecycle.Implement and configure(Deployment) OPA (Open Policy Agent) for policy-based governance and access control.Configure and manage Istio for service mesh functionality, including traffic management, security, and observability.Utilize Kibana and FluentD for log aggregation, analysis, and visualization.Implement Kayenta/Spinnaker for automated canary analysis and testing.Implement and configure OpenTelemetry for observability and monitoring.Utilize Azure Monitor for infrastructure and application monitoring and alerting.Monitor and troubleshoot infrastructure, application, and deployment issues using appropriate tools and techniques.Implement and maintain automated testing frameworks and strategies for ensuring software quality and reliability.Collaborate with cross-functional teams to gather requirements, provide technical expertise, and drive DevOps best practices.Stay up-to-date with industry trends, tools, and technologies related to DevOps, cloud computing, and containerization.Self learner to find what is neededRequirements:

Strong experience in implementing CI/CD pipelines using Azure DevOps or similar tools.In-depth knowledge of containerization technologies like AKS, Docker, and Kubernetes.Familiarity with Canary deployment strategies and related tools.Experience with package management using Helm.Knowledge of install, implement and maintain OPA and integrate with Istio.Familiarity with Istio and service mesh concepts.Experience with log aggregation and visualization tools like Kibana and FluentD.Familiarity with automated canary analysis using Kayenta.Experience with observability and monitoring tools like OpenTelemetry and Azure Monitor.Strong scripting and automation skills (e.g., PowerShell, Bash, Python).Experience working with cloud platforms (Azure preferred).Solid understanding of software development practices and agile methodologies.Excellent troubleshooting and problem-solving skills.Strong communication and collaboration skills to work effectively in cross-functional teams.Experience in working on highly regulated environmentPreferred Qualifications:Relevant certifications in Azure, Kubernetes, or DevOps.Knowledge of security best practices and technologies.Previous experience in a similar DevOps role.